There is no other option in this pursuit, except to give up the longing for sense objects, is the very first instruction which is also very difficult to follow. To help us in this endeavour, it is advised that we learn to consider sense objects as poison and shun them totally. We have to understand how sense objects poison the mind. The wise instead consciously control the mind and direct it to seek the valuable nectar derived by the practice of moral virtues such as forgiveness, kindness and contentment. These make one self-dependent rather than sense-dependent.
